I have black silkies and WCB polish. oddly enough, the males from these crosses always have orangey red highlights in their feathers, while the hens are solid black. .
idunno.gif
it helps to tell the hens from the roosters at a young age though
lol.png
they have 5 toes, light leg feathering, small crests, soft, cochin like body feather, and, in my opinion, absolutely gross, huge, chewed up gum combs
sickbyc.gif
they lay better then some of my leghorns and I have given some to my family, and they say they hatch eggs like a silkie
thumbsup.gif
. About half will be bearded, the rest will be non if you have a bearded silkie and a nonbearded polish. Also, the mother was the silkie, the father the polish, any other questions just ask
